View File

@ -28,31 +28,55 @@ enum VoteOption {
// WeightedVoteOption defines a unit of vote for vote split.
message WeightedVoteOption {
// option defines the valid vote options, it must not contain duplicate vote options.
VoteOption option = 1;
// weight is the vote weight associated with the vote option.
string weight = 2 [(cosmos_proto.scalar) = "cosmos.Dec"];
}
// Deposit defines an amount deposited by an account address to an active
// proposal.
message Deposit {
// proposal_id defines the unique id of the proposal.
uint64 proposal_id = 1;
// depositor defines the deposit addresses from the proposals.
string depositor = 2 [(cosmos_proto.scalar) = "cosmos.AddressString"];
// amount to be deposited by depositor.
repeated cosmos.base.v1beta1.Coin amount = 3 [(gogoproto.nullable) = false, (amino.dont_omitempty) = true];
}
// Proposal defines the core field members of a governance proposal.
message Proposal {
// id defines the unique id of the proposal.
uint64 id = 1;
// messages are the arbitrary messages to be executed if the proposal passes.
repeated google.protobuf.Any messages = 2;
// status defines the proposal status.
ProposalStatus status = 3;
// final_tally_result is the final tally result of the proposal. When
// querying a proposal via gRPC, this field is not populated until the
// proposal's voting period has ended.
TallyResult final_tally_result = 4;
// submit_time is the time of proposal submission.
google.protobuf.Timestamp submit_time = 5 [(gogoproto.stdtime) = true];
// deposit_end_time is the end time for deposition.
google.protobuf.Timestamp deposit_end_time = 6 [(gogoproto.stdtime) = true];
// total_deposit is the total deposit on the proposal.
repeated cosmos.base.v1beta1.Coin total_deposit = 7 [(gogoproto.nullable) = false, (amino.dont_omitempty) = true];
// voting_start_time is the starting time to vote on a proposal.
google.protobuf.Timestamp voting_start_time = 8 [(gogoproto.stdtime) = true];
// voting_end_time is the end time of voting on a proposal.
google.protobuf.Timestamp voting_end_time = 9 [(gogoproto.stdtime) = true];

@ -82,18 +106,28 @@ enum ProposalStatus {
// TallyResult defines a standard tally for a governance proposal.
message TallyResult {
// yes_count is the number of yes votes on a proposal.
string yes_count = 1 [(cosmos_proto.scalar) = "cosmos.Int"];
// abstain_count is the number of abstain votes on a proposal.
string abstain_count = 2 [(cosmos_proto.scalar) = "cosmos.Int"];
// no_count is the number of no votes on a proposal.
string no_count = 3 [(cosmos_proto.scalar) = "cosmos.Int"];
// no_with_veto_count is the number of no with veto votes on a proposal.
string no_with_veto_count = 4 [(cosmos_proto.scalar) = "cosmos.Int"];
}
// Vote defines a vote on a governance proposal.
// A Vote consists of a proposal ID, the voter, and the vote option.
message Vote {
// proposal_id defines the unique id of the proposal.
uint64 proposal_id = 1;
// voter is the voter address of the proposal.
string voter = 2 [(cosmos_proto.scalar) = "cosmos.AddressString"];
reserved 3;
// options is the weighted vote options.
repeated WeightedVoteOption options = 4;
// metadata is any arbitrary metadata to attached to the vote.
